SummaryNO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that Orange County, Florida, henceforth referred to as the County is accepting sealed responses for AI Assisted Environmental Monitoring and Response ( Y26-04-RFI )
Sealed offers for furnishing the above will be accepted up to 4:00 pm EST on Tuesday, March 31, 2026 .
-
NOTE: Respondents are required to submit responses electronically via the OpenGov e-Procurement Platform.Respondents shall not be permitted to hand-deliver, mail, telephone, fax or email offers.
Responses received after the submission deadline and/or transmitted outside of the designated OpenGov e-Procurement Platform shall be rejected.
BackgroundOrange County exercises the rights and privileges conveyed to it by the State of Florida, and the Orange County Charter. It presently operates with an elected chief executive officer, Orange County Mayor, and six elected district commissioners, who together comprise the Board of County Commissioners.
Procurement is an essential function of the County, affecting all operational departments, ongoing projects and future initiatives. The Procurement Division is divided into three (3) Sections, the “Buying Section”, the “Purchasing Section” and the “Contracts Section”.
The Orange County Procurement Division operates under the leadership of Carrie Mathes, MPA, NIGP-CPP, CFCM, CPPO, CPPB as Procurement Division Manager and Chief Procurement Official in accordance with the Orange County Ordinance.
